Un contrat de développement web WordPress est bien plus qu'une simple formalité. Il est le garant de la réussite de tout projet en définissant les règles de livraison, de communication et de prise de décision.
Lorsque les contrats sont vagues, les attentes divergent et les suppositions comblent les lacunes. Les clients présument que certaines fonctionnalités sont incluses, tandis que les agences supposent que les limites sont évidentes.
Si vous dirigez une agence WordPress ou proposez des services de développement, votre contrat détermine le bon déroulement de vos projets et la prévisibilité de vos revenus.
Ce guide passe en revue les clauses les plus importantes qu'un de développement WordPress devrait inclure et explique comment chacune d'elles permet de prévenir les litiges courants avant qu'ils ne surviennent.
En bref : Contrat de développement WordPress
- Un contrat de développement WordPress définit clairement les attentes en matière de périmètre, de prix, de délais et de responsabilités.
- Des contrats bien rédigés permettent d'éviter les dérives du périmètre du contrat, les litiges relatifs aux paiements et les cycles de révision interminables.
- Chaque contrat doit définir clairement la structure des paiements, les livrables, les droits de propriété, les limites de révision et les responsabilités du client.
- Il convient de mentionner les plugins tiers et les outils open source afin que les agences ne soient pas tenues responsables de problèmes externes.
- Les limites de migration et de formatage du contenu doivent être documentées afin d'éviter le travail non rémunéré.
- La sécurité, les mises à jour et la maintenance devraient faire l'objet d'un contrat séparé.
- Des contrats solides protègent vos revenus, votre équipe et vos relations clients.
- Si votre contrat est vague, vos projets le seront aussi.
Pourquoi les projets WordPress échouent-ils en l'absence d'un contrat clair ?
La plupart des problèmes rencontrés dans les projets WordPress ne sont pas dus à de mauvaises intentions. Ils proviennent plutôt de suppositions et d'attentes tacites de part et d'autre.
Les clients pensent souvent qu'un site web comprend tout ce qu'ils imaginent. Les agences, quant à elles, supposent souvent que les clients comprennent ce qui est techniquement complexe, chronophage ou hors du cadre du projet.

Sans clarté écrite, de petits malentendus se transforment en désaccords majeurs qui ralentissent les projets et mettent à rude épreuve les relations. Un contrat solide ne crée pas de frictions ; il les élimine en remplaçant les suppositions par des accords écrits.
Lancez un site WordPress sans tâtonner
Un contrat clair est essentiel. Tout comme un partenaire WordPress fiable. Seahawk Media crée des sites web WordPress performants et évolutifs, avec un périmètre défini et sans incertitudes.
Ce que les agences attendent par rapport à ce que les clients supposent ?
Les agences attendent de leurs clients qu'ils fournissent le contenu dans les délais et qu'ils approuvent rapidement les maquettes. Elles attendent également de leurs clients qu'ils comprennent que les modifications ont une incidence sur les délais et les coûts.
Les clients s'attendent souvent à des révisions illimitées, des modifications instantanées et à la pleine propriété de tout ce qui est produit pendant le projet. Les deux parties ont raison dans leur façon de penser.
Ils raisonnent simplement à partir de perspectives différentes. Votre contrat est le point de rencontre et d'harmonisation de ces perspectives.
Comment un contrat solide peut-il éviter les conversations embarrassantes ?
Lorsque les attentes sont formalisées par écrit, les discussions restent objectives et non émotionnelles. On se réfère aux termes convenus plutôt qu'à des opinions personnelles.
Au lieu de négocier sous pression, vous suivez des règles et des processus prédéfinis. Cela préserve les relations et assure la progression des projets.
Les clauses essentielles que tout contrat de développement web WordPress devrait inclure
professionnel de développement web ne devrait pas ressembler à un casse-tête juridique rempli de jargon obscur. Il devrait plutôt expliquer clairement le déroulement du projet et la gestion des modifications.
Les clauses suivantes constituent l'épine dorsale des contrats qui permettent aux agences de se développer au lieu de les ralentir.

Structure et étapes de paiement
Les discussions financières deviennent délicates lorsque les attentes sont floues ou non formalisées par écrit. Un contrat clair et précis explique exactement comment et quand vous serez payé.
Votre contrat doit préciser les modalités de dépôt, les paiements d'étape et le paiement final avant le lancement. Ainsi, les clients comprennent le déroulement financier dès le départ.
La plupart des agences fonctionnent selon un modèle où les travaux débutent après le versement d'un acompte et le site n'est mis en ligne qu'après réception du solde. Cela préserve votre trésorerie et instaure un climat professionnel tout au long de la collaboration.
Votre contrat doit également préciser les conséquences d'un retard de paiement, telles que la suspension des travaux ou l'application de pénalités de retard. Des conditions de paiement claires évitent les incertitudes et réduisent le risque de relances pour non-paiement.
Étendue des travaux et livrables
Le périmètre est la section la plus importante de votre contrat car il définit ce que vous construisez. Il définit également ce que vous ne construisez pas.
Votre cahier des charges doit détailler le nombre de pages, de modèles, de fonctionnalités, d'intégrations et de caractéristiques incluses dans le prix indiqué.
Si un élément n'est pas listé, il n'est pas inclus dans le projet. Cela vous protège des demandes d'ajouts incessantes déguisées en modifications mineures.
Une définition claire du périmètre des projets permet de les rendre prévisibles et rentables.
Propriété et droits de propriété intellectuelle
Les clients partent souvent du principe qu'ils sont propriétaires de tout par défaut, y compris des fichiers de conception bruts et du code source. Les agences, quant à elles, partent souvent du principe qu'elles conservent le code réutilisable et les frameworks internes.
Votre contrat doit clairement indiquer qui est propriétaire du site web final et qui possède les fichiers de conception originaux. Il doit également préciser si votre agence peut réutiliser le code ou les composants pour des projets futurs. Des conditions de propriété claires permettent d'éviter les litiges longtemps après le lancement.
Utilisation de plugins, thèmes et outils open source tiers
Les projets WordPress dépendent fortement de logiciels tiers. Les plugins, les thèmeset les bibliothèques open source sont créés et maintenus par des développeurs externes.
Votre contrat devrait préciser que vous assemblez et configurez un logiciel existant plutôt que de développer chaque ligne de code à partir de zéro.
Il convient également de préciser que les mises à jour tierces peuvent parfois entraîner des dysfonctionnements. Vous pouvez également indiquer clairement que la maintenance continue du site constitue un service distinct.
Cela vous protège contre le risque d'être tenu responsable de problèmes indépendants de votre volonté.
Responsabilité du contenu et limites de migration
La création de contenu prend plus de temps que la plupart des clients ne l'imaginent. Le chargement des pages, la mise en forme du texte, le redimensionnement des images, la création des fiches produitset l'intégration des vidéos nécessitent tous une préparation minutieuse.
Votre contrat doit préciser la quantité de contenu que vous téléchargerez et mettrez en forme dans le cadre du projet. Définissez le nombre de pages, d'articles, de produits et d'images inclus.
Précisez si les clients fournissent le contenu final ou si la rédaction est incluse. Sans cette clause, le contenu devient rapidement une charge de travail non rémunérée illimitée.
Politique de révision et demandes de modification
Les révisions illimitées compromettent les délais et les marges. Votre contrat doit préciser le nombre de séries de révisions incluses dans le prix du projet.
Il convient également de définir ce qui constitue une révision par rapport à une nouvelle demande. Par exemple, ajuster l'espacement est une révision. Ajouter une nouvelle section relève d'un nouveau périmètre.
Il convient également de définir les modalités de soumission des demandes de révision et les délais impartis. Cela permet de centraliser les retours et de faire avancer les projets.
Calendrier du projet et dépendances du client
Les agences ne peuvent avancer qu'au rythme des réponses des clients. Votre contrat doit définir clairement les responsabilités du client, notamment la fourniture de contenu, les approbations et les retours d'information dans un délai précis.
Il convient également d'inclure une clause stipulant que des retards prolongés de la part du client peuvent entraîner des modifications d'échéancier ou nécessiter un report. Cela vous protège contre les délais irréalistes dus à l'inaction du client.
Limites de compatibilité entre navigateurs et appareils
Il est irréaliste de prendre en charge tous les navigateurs et appareils existants. Votre contrat doit préciser les navigateurs et appareils sur lesquels vous effectuez les tests.
Cela inclut généralement les versions modernes de Chrome, Safari, Firefox, Edge et les systèmes d'exploitation mobiles actuels.
Vous pouvez également exclure les navigateurs obsolètes ou non pris en charge. Cela évite un débogage interminable sur des technologies dépassées.
Exigences relatives à l'environnement d'hébergement
Les performances et la sécurité de WordPress dépendent fortement de l'environnement d'hébergement. Tous les hébergeurs sont pas conçus pour gérer correctement les sites WordPress modernes.
Votre contrat doit préciser les exigences minimales d'hébergement nécessaires au bon fonctionnement du site. Cela peut inclure les versions de PHP, les versions de la base de données, les limites de mémoire et la prise en charge SSL.
Vous devez également préciser que les problèmes liés à un hébergement inadéquat ne relèvent pas de votre responsabilité. Si un client choisit un hébergeur de mauvaise qualité malgré vos recommandations, vous ne pouvez garantir ni ses performances ni la stabilité de son hébergement.
Cette clause vous protège contre toute accusation concernant des problèmes liés aux limitations du serveur.
Risques liés au lancement et à la migration de sites web
Le lancement ou la migration d'un site web est l'une des phases les plus délicates de tout projet. Même avec une planification minutieuse, de petits problèmes peuvent survenir.
Votre contrat doit préciser que les modifications DNS, la propagation des serveurs et les mises à jour de la configuration de la messagerie peuvent entraîner des interruptions de service temporaires. Les clients doivent prendre en compte cette possibilité avant le lancement.
Il convient également de préciser que des bugs mineurs ou des problèmes d'affichage peuvent survenir après la mise en ligne et nécessiter des tests ultérieurs. Ces incidents sont inhérents au passage d'un site web en production.
Cette clause permet de fixer des attentes réalistes et d'éviter la panique en cas de petits contretemps.
Responsabilités en matière de sécurité après le lancement
Une fois un site web mis en ligne, la sécurité devient une responsabilité permanente. Il ne s'agit pas d'une tâche ponctuelle effectuée lors du développement.
Votre contrat doit préciser si vous êtes responsable des sauvegardes, des mises à jour, des analyses antiviruset de la surveillance après le lancement. Dans le cas contraire, cela doit être clairement indiqué.
Vous devez également expliquer que les sites web piratés, les mots de passe compromis ou les plugins obsolètes ne font pas partie du périmètre de la version initiale.
Cela ouvre naturellement la porte à la proposition de plans de maintenance ou de support WordPress distincts.
Période de garantie et fenêtre de correction des bugs
La plupart des agences offrent une courte période de garantie après la mise en service. Celle-ci couvre les bugs liés au périmètre initial des travaux. Votre contrat doit préciser la durée de cette garantie, par exemple quatorze ou trente jours.
Il convient également de préciser que la garantie ne s'applique pas aux nouvelles demandes de fonctionnalités ni aux modifications apportées par des plugins tiers. Cela évite un support gratuit continu déguisé en correction de bugs.
Arrêt anticipé et abandon du projet
Tous les projets n'aboutissent pas. Il arrive que les clients changent d'avis, suspendent leurs activités ou disparaissent complètement.
Votre contrat doit préciser les modalités de résiliation anticipée du projet par l'une ou l'autre des parties. Il doit notamment indiquer le montant des sommes dues et les fichiers à livrer.
Il est également important de définir les modalités de résiliation en cas d'inactivité prolongée d'un client. Cela vous évite de laisser des projets inachevés indéfiniment. Des conditions de résiliation claires vous protègent du temps et des revenus.
Compétence légale et limites de responsabilité
Les litiges sont rares, mais les contrats doivent prévoir les pires scénarios. Espérer que tout se passera bien ne remplace pas la planification.
Votre contrat doit préciser quelle juridiction régit l'accord et où toute action en justice doit être intentée.
Il convient également de limiter votre responsabilité au montant payé pour le projet. Cela permet d'éviter des réclamations importantes liées à des pertes commerciales perçues. Cette clause protège votre agence contre les risques disproportionnés.
Confidentialité et protection des accords de non-divulgation
Au cours d'un projet, les clients partagent souvent des informations commerciales sensibles, telles que des identifiants, des stratégies et des données confidentielles.
Votre contrat doit stipuler que les deux parties s'engagent à préserver la confidentialité des informations partagées. Vous pouvez également préciser la durée de cette obligation de confidentialité après la fin du projet. Cela renforce la confiance et protège les deux parties.
Pourquoi la maintenance WordPress devrait-elle faire l'objet d'un contrat séparé ?
La création et la maintenance d'un site web sont deux services distincts. Les regrouper dans un seul contrat engendre de la confusion.
Votre contrat de développement doit porter sur la création et la mise en ligne du site web. Les contrats de maintenance doivent couvrir les mises à jour, les sauvegardes, la sécurité et le suivi des performances.

La séparation de ces accords clarifie les prix et évite les attentes de soutien illimité. Elle génère également des revenus récurrents et prévisibles pour votre agence.
Réflexions finales : Contrat de développement web
Un contrat de développement web n'a pas pour but d'être excessivement strict ou difficile. Il s'agit d'instaurer la clarté, l'alignement et la confiance entre les deux parties avant le début des travaux.
Lorsque votre contrat définit clairement le périmètre, les responsabilités, les limites et les processus, les projets se déroulent plus facilement. Les clients savent à quoi s'attendre. Votre équipe sait ce qu'elle doit livrer. Cette compréhension partagée permet d'éviter la plupart des conflits avant même qu'ils ne surviennent.
Si vous souhaitez développer une activité WordPress pérenne, considérez votre contrat comme un atout stratégique, et non comme un modèle téléchargé il y a des années. Mettez-le à jour régulièrement et améliorez-le au fur et à mesure que vos services évoluent.
Des contrats solides permettent de mener à bien des projets plus ambitieux, d'entretenir des relations clients plus saines et de pérenniser l'agence. Et cette base solide facilite le développement de toutes les autres étapes.
Foire aux questions
Que doit inclure un contrat de développement web WordPress ?
Un contrat de développement web WordPress doit inclure les modalités de paiement, le périmètre du projet, les droits de propriété intellectuelle, les limites de révision, les délais, les responsabilités en matière de sécurité et les clauses de résiliation. Ces sections définissent le déroulement du projet et les responsabilités de chacun.
À qui appartient le site web une fois le projet terminé ?
La propriété dépend des termes de votre contrat. De nombreuses agences transfèrent la propriété du site web final tout en conservant les droits sur les frameworks internes ou le code réutilisable.
Combien de révisions sont raisonnables ?
La plupart des agences prévoient une à trois séries de révisions et facturent séparément toute révision supplémentaire.
Les agences ont-elles besoin de contrats de maintenance distincts ?
Oui. Les agences devraient gérer la maintenance par le biais d'un accord distinct afin de définir clairement le périmètre du support continu, des mises à jour et de la sécurité, et de les facturer en conséquence.